PrivateBin/tst
El RIDO b25022e403 refactored JSON API, its now possible to retrieve pastes as JSON, which
is now used when posting comments, eliminating the need to store the
password in sessionStorage
2015-09-01 22:33:07 +02:00
..
zerobin concluding work on configuration test generator for #16. Replaced a few 2015-08-29 20:29:14 +02:00
.gitignore slight configuration changes, template modifications to make discussions 2015-08-31 00:01:35 +02:00
auto.php reviewed unit tests, fixing line endings, added more tests 2015-08-15 18:32:31 +02:00
bootstrap.php refining configuration test generator, now supporting conditions on 2015-08-29 10:41:10 +02:00
configGenerator.php slight configuration changes, template modifications to make discussions 2015-08-31 00:01:35 +02:00
filter.php Time attack protection on hmac comparison 2015-08-15 23:44:03 +02:00
phpunit.xml working on configuration unit test generator as described in #16 2015-08-29 01:26:48 +02:00
RainTPL.php slight configuration changes, template modifications to make discussions 2015-08-31 00:01:35 +02:00
README.md removed leftovers from submodule uglifyjs, added credits file, 2012-08-26 00:49:11 +02:00
serversalt.php created initial unit tests for main zerobin class 2015-08-27 23:30:35 +02:00
sjcl.php reviewed unit tests, fixing line endings, added more tests 2015-08-15 18:32:31 +02:00
test.ini slight configuration changes, template modifications to make discussions 2015-08-31 00:01:35 +02:00
trafficlimiter.php reviewed unit tests, fixing line endings, added more tests 2015-08-15 18:32:31 +02:00
vizhash16x16.php fixing nasty deletion bug from #15, included unit tests to trigger it 2015-08-27 21:41:21 +02:00
zerobin.php refactored JSON API, its now possible to retrieve pastes as JSON, which 2015-09-01 22:33:07 +02:00

Running unit tests

In order to run these tests, you will need to install the following packages and its dependencies:

  • phpunit
  • php5-gd
  • php5-sqlite
  • php5-xdebug

Example for Debian and Ubuntu: $ sudo aptitude install phpunit php5-mysql php5-xdebug

To run the tests, just change into this directory and run phpunit: $ cd ZeroBin/tst $ phpunit